the output on the tv, video or audio is bad becos the input is poor.

in addition, the tv player for playback or online streams is an average one, good for convenience and basic streams/playback.

tv makers are not player makers, they focus on the display which is their biz, not the player.


to get the better picture on the tv, u will need a better source, a better player and for audio, a full home theater system.

and yes... this means more $$$.... the tv cannot do what other specialized devices do.

basic windows +vlc will give decent quality, better than tv player for playback.

but unless u pay for pro versions, u won't be able to play full bluray or 4k files.

that can be found in box players priced rm600-2k... they come with full menu, full video+audio codecs.

Problem solved. I connect LAN cable and switch the machine on. Turned off Wifi. and wait it out a bit, before clicking Netflix. Prompted to update software, so clicked OK.

it downloaded the software update and install the new updates. took around 8mins. walaaa, problem solved!

ah... this likely meant yr wifi connection was very poor... either yr router or distance or tv wifi module - this u gotta check.

the tv ethernet/lan max out at 100mbps but wifi 5ghz can do >200mbps.

i had always used with wifi, no issue.
